Start for freeWhat to Expect
In Timelag, you command spaceships battling across outer space, where Einsteinian time dilation directly affects gameplay. As years pass, civilizations advance technologically, producing better ships than before. The key challenge is that ships age differently relative to their home bases, making it uncertain how 'old' enemy ships really are. The game uses a hex grid and movement points to simulate complex space maneuvers and combat.

How It Works
Players move their ships on a hexagonal board using movement points. Combat is resolved with a ratio and combat results table system that simulates realistic outcomes. Time dilation influences technological development and the relative aging of ships compared to their bases. This requires forward planning and adapting strategies to evolving conditions.
